代码提示完全是摆设

该提示的不提示,不该提示的倒一大堆,每次瞧代码还要看下API完整的函数名才行,效率太低了,希望下个版本能完善

赞同, 每次都是代码编辑器硬伤

用VSCode啊

VSCode提示代码也不全,很多方法没有

代码提示确实不好用

自己封装的一些模块都没有提示,写起相当痛苦。
还的自己写一个.d.ts文件才给提示
还有cc命名空间下的好多可以用的类,都不给提示,官网给的提示.d.ts里没有加,就没有提示,
简直是恶心!

建议在 creator 打开JS文件可以直接打开VS code编辑

你们说的代码提示问题指的是内置的代码编辑器还是VSCode?VSCode的话是根据文档注释自动生成.d.ts文件的。有些可能是因为文档问题导致生成的.d.ts文件有问题,有些可能是生成代码的问题。

麻烦你们把问题说清楚一下,是哪个提示没有,能有截图更好。

this.没提示,只有cc.才有提示是什么鬼?

creator.d.ts里确实有不少错误。太多了无法一一列出,建议用webstorm打开一下,就能看到了。

自从用了cocos creator,我的记忆力呈几何式上升,对API什么的练就了过目不忘的本领,感谢cocos creator,感谢触控

2赞

乖乖打开API页面,随时查。

常用的基本上可以记住了。

不要追求代码提示了。

放弃研究代码提示后,反而一身轻松。

1赞

最佳的代码提示做法是用webstorm,把引擎中的源码拷贝过来,添加到webstorm的library中。

#为啥这么久了官方不说怎么解决呢

这个问题的解决是不是遥遥无期了?

比如this.node.getComponent(cc.Canvas).fitWdith = true;
写错了一个字母,不会提示不会报错,很不容易察觉到。

有优先度呀。 代码提示再好,做出来的东西用不了 有什么用呢。 所以官方现在还是主力提升引擎的能力比较好

nantas大大解释过做语法树的引擎组大神目前手上都有更重要的任务。不过应该代码提示的优先级会提前吧?
目前想要完善的代码提示的话,容我安利一波TypeScript:
http://forum.cocos.com/t/typescript-creator-github/42200

1赞

讲道理 js 的代码是个难题, 所以代码提示要怪cocos了
看了 @toddlxt 的方案 觉得是个不错的选择.